In relation to directions issued under section 42 (2) of the
Corruption and Crime Commission Act 2003
, I ask, since the election of the Barnett Government, on how many occasions has the CCC,
(a) directed the police and/or any other authority not to commence investigation of a misconduct matter;
(b) directed the police and/or any other authority to discontinue investigation of a misconduct matter; and
(c) directed the police and/or any other authority that an investigation of a misconduct matter is not conducted by an officer of the appropriate authority?

Since the election of the Barnett Government (6 September 2008), the Corruption and Crime Commission ("the Commission") has issued 44 notices pursuant to section 42(2) of the
Corruption and Crime Commission Act 2003
. Accordingly the Commission provides the following answers to the above questions.
(a) Seven.
(b) Thirty-seven (37).
(c) Forty-four (44). All section 42(2) notices contain this direction.
